Break-Glass Access — Bouncewright Processor

If the Bouncewright bounce-processing queue stalls during a release and on-call cannot respond, the release manager may invoke break-glass access. Log the incident number first, then open the emergency console. Access auto-expires after 20 minutes and triggers an audit review. To unlock the console, enter the passphrase shown below.

unlock words, hahip-yagef: zorok-novmir-zorix-silax

Handover for the weekly eng sync: I'm transferring ownership of Duskrunner, our nightly backfill scheduler, to Priya. Current state: all jobs healthy except the ledger-reconciliation backfill, which retries once nightly due to a slow upstream from the Kestwick warehouse. Retry logic, window sizing, and concurrency caps were all tuned carefully last quarter — please don't change them without a load test. For full transparency at the sync, the production instance runs with these configuration values.

settings of hawep-kadug:
RALAEL_HOST=ralael.tolvaqlabs.internal
RALAEL_PORT=9000

# Dedup layer for the Quillbrook on-call alerter.
# Incoming alerts are hashed on (service, signal, severity) and collapsed
# into a single page within a rolling window. This keeps a flapping host
# from paging the rotation forty times in five minutes. New folks: do not
# widen the window without checking with the rota lead, since it also
# delays genuinely new pages. The current production constants are listed below.

tuning table, yajog-yahof:
BUDGETS = {
    "lamvan": 303,
    "wenox": 460,
    "fenvan": 525,
}